concept art: Dot in alley

Real quick update this time. Finished a conceptual piece of Dot standing in an alleyway. I was looking at a painting by Craig Mullins as a guide for the background. Dot’s costume was designed by Albert Truong, a very awesome concept artist and illustrator I worked with last year. This image was an experiment combining colored line art for the character and a more painterly approach for the background.
